A Student Life Less Ordinary
The Tayforth University Officer Training Corps (Tayforth UOTC) offers a unique experience to university students looking to challenge and develop themselves, make life-long friends and get paid.
You'll receive internationally recognised military and leadership training along with the opportunity to immerse yourself in a variety of sports and adventurous training activities. The training is designed to fit around your academic commitments.
You are under no obligation to join the Regular Army or Army Reserves after your time with the UOTC finishes.
Eligibility
Tayforth UOTC recruits from:
Abertay University, Dundee University, Highlands and Islands University, St Andrews University and Stirling University.

Sport and Adventurous Training
Tayforth UOTC fields competitive teams in many disciplines such as Rugby, Hockey, Netball, Football and much more. As an Officer Cadet you will be supported to try new sports and even compete at the highest levels in your chosen field.
Adventurous Training features strongly throughout the UOTC year and enables Officer Cadets to test and stretch their limits. You can train in anything from kayaking in the UK to skiing the Alps, rock climbing in Bavaria and everything in between.
